June 23, 2020 — Spartan Scientific, manufacturer of fluid & pneumatic automation components, announces that its line of air-piloted valves now includes their APVS Media Separated Valve Series. This series is comprised of four different styles of APVS valves and provides options for handling caustic media, all while allowing safe operation in volatile areas. The series includes inert gas/spring-operated valves to control high-purity, aggressive, and corrosive liquid chemicals while allowing a flow rate superior to other similar valves on the market. Each APVS Valve can be configured to meet critical user requirements with ordering options that include various port sizes, diaphragm seal materials, pilot options, and valve function.

In addition, an optional magnetic piston is available for end-of-stroke position sensing and can be combined with a magnetic position sensor to maintain positive feedback. Some common applications for the APVS series include:

  • Food and liquid dispensing or processing
  • Irrigation
  • Potable water treatment
  • Harsh chemical processing, injection, and handling
  • Pharmaceutical and analytical processing
  • Dialysis systems, etc.
